Radiopaque contrast agent that attenuates X-rays, providing visualization of vascular and urinary structures. It is a high-osmolality ionic dimer that distributes in extracellular fluid and is excreted renally.
Pantopaque is an iodinated oil-based contrast agent that attenuates X-rays, allowing visualization of the subarachnoid space during myelography. It acts as a positive contrast medium by increasing the absorption of X-rays in the cerebrospinal fluid.
Intra-arterial or intravenous administration; adult dose varies by procedure: for intravenous urography, 50-100 mL of 60% solution; for CT enhancement, 100-150 mL of 60% solution; maximum total dose 4.2 g iodine/kg body weight.
Adults: 5-15 mL (6-18 g iophendylate) intrathecally for myelography via lumbar puncture. No repeated dosing.
